Dexter Track & Field played host to neighboring Ann Arbor Pioneer high school at Al Ritt on Tuesday. Again cold temperatures might have kept some performances down, but not the Dreads competitive spirit. The boys won by a score of 71-66, and the girls team came up short by a margin of 86-51.
Top performers on the boys side started with Mitchell Ward taking 3rd in the 100m at 11.78, and 2nd in the 200m with a time of 24.28. Connor Kril finished 3rd at 24.37. The 400m saw Liam Smith winning with 56.58, and Jason Biggs 3rd at 58.30. Nick Reiser also took 3rd place in the 800m running a 2:08.85 time.
Caleb Snyder placed in both the 3200m, going 3rd with his time of 10:36.45, and 2nd in the 1600m with 4:32.73. Coen Hill was right behind in 3rd with a time of 4:33.87.

Dexter swept the 110m High Hurdles with Adler Mesko (20.07), Oliver Barth (20.84), and Owen Sorter (21.38) going 1-2-3. Sorter also placed 3rd in the 300m Hurdles with his time of 53.02.
Dexter swept 4 different field event competitions. The trio of Dexter throwers Robert Karageorge (43’ 2.5”), Cameron Clark (43’ 1.5”), and Colin McIntyre (40’ 7.5”) swept the Shot Put, and then followed that up with the same order with another sweep in the Boys Discus with Karageorge (127’ 2”), Clark (108’ 7”) and McIntyre (103’ 6”). In the High Jump, Kyle Gerharter won at 5’ 8”, Gavin Heichel 2nd at 5’ 6”, and Amarkus Royce 3rd at 5’ 6”. Not to be out done, the Boys Pole Vault placed Anthony Delarca-Hernandes 1st at 11’ 6”, followed by Alex Trisdale at 10’ 0”, and Charles Baker in 3rd at 8’ 6”. The Dreads picked up a 2nd and 3rd place in the Long Jump with Collin Roller, and Pearson Taylor going 16’ 6.25”, and 15’ 11.5” respectively.
Continuing with the Girls field events, the Lady Dreads swept the Discus with Kera Root winning with a toss of 94’ 1”, Alice Trinkle 2nd at 69’ 10”, and Emily Weiszhaar 3rd with 68’ 2”. Root and Weiszhaar also went 1-3 in the Shot Put with throws of 29’ 11.5”, and 24’ 9” respectively. Girls Pole Vault also was a 1-2-3 finish for the Dreads. Raiden Kipfmiller was 1st at 11’ 6”, Debbie McCoy 2nd at 10’ 6” and Lana Riley 3rd at 8’ 0”. Ainsley Davis had the farthest Long Jump of the day, winning with a leap of 13’ 9.5”, and teammate Larkin Pham took 3r at 13” 3.75”. Davis also placed in the High Jump, going 4’ 10” to take 3rd.
Kipfmiller continued out on the track, as the winner of the girls 200m dash with a time of 28.02 and Maddy Church 3rd at 29.29. Dexter had a 1-2 finish in the 400m with Amelia Cribbins 1st at 1:05.63, and Claire Gibson 2nd at 1:06.77. Annabel O’Haver won the 3200m at 12:15.81, and Lillian Mitchell was 3rd in the 1600m with her time of 5:32.14.
